



Burner Unit Assembly
The Burner Unit Assembly is the complete combustion system component responsible for mixing fuel and combustion air in the correct ratio and igniting them to generate the controlled flame that heats industrial furnaces, kilns, and boilers. Burner performance directly determines furnace temperature uniformity, fuel consumption efficiency, and NOx emissions — making burner specification and maintenance quality critical operational and environmental compliance factors. - Gas Burner Assemblies: Complete natural gas and LPG burner units for reheating furnaces, heat treatment furnaces, and rotary kilns in various heat input ratings.
- Oil Burner Assemblies: Pressure-atomizing and air-atomizing oil burner units for furnaces operating on heavy fuel oil or light diesel.
- Dual-Fuel Burner Units: Combination gas/oil burner assemblies allowing fuel switching without burner replacement during fuel supply disruptions.
- Burner Blocks: Pre-cast high-alumina refractory tiles forming the burner throat and flame stabilization zone within the furnace wall.
- Ignition Electrodes & Transformers: Spark ignition components for automatic burner management systems with UV flame detection.
- Combustion Air Blowers: Forced draft blower units matched to specific burner air pressure and volume flow requirements.
